A program felépítése

turbo pascal program felépítés {Programfejléc - nem kötelező}
PROGRAM programnév;
{deklarációs rész}
USES unitnév; {az alkalmazni kívánt unitok meghatározása}
A unitok a program segédeszközei, ezeket a megadás után lehet használni.
Unitok pl: CRT, DOS, Graph, Overlay, Printer, System, Graph3, Turbo3
CONST pi=3.1415 {a programban használandó konstansok megadása}
TYPE {típusok deklarációja}
VAR {változók deklarációja}
LABEL {címzések deklarációja - a GOTO parancshoz}
PROCEDURE {eljárások megadása}
FUNCTION {függvények megadása}
{a főprogram}
BEGIN {a főprogram kezdőszava}
END. {a főprogram vége}